We were not happy with The Richmond on any level!! No air-conditioning and had to pay for them to put it i the window. When moved my father in law in the air conditioner hadn't been installed, the room was stifling. The answer we got was they needed us to buy an extention cord. Would've been nice to have known that beforehand. Due to covid he had to be in isolation for 14 days which we understood. He needed all the extra care available to him and we were more than willing to pay for any and all that he needed til he could be placed in a nursing home. Because of covid we were unable to visit him for 14 days, which, again we understood. When we could visit he was always wearing urine stained and urine smelling pants among other things. We were beginning to wonder if the care we were paying for was actually being done. He got infection several times and each time theyd send him to hospital and when he'd return he would go back to 14 days isolation. This happened 3 times. He was miserable living there. The last time he was admitted to hospital for infection he never returned. It was not a good prognosis and when hospital Dr asked for him to come back to The Richmond, they refused to care for him anymore. More time went by and he was put on a waitlist for a hospice as they were full. The decision was he was going to have to stay in hospital til he passed. So 2 weeks passed and he did just pass. We went back to The Richmond to move his things out and we were told that we had to pay for another months rent as we didn't give them a month's notice!!! Are you kidding me!!! So heartless and no compassion. Went to his room and it was disgusting. It had ever been cleaned. The smell of urine hit us as soon as we opened the door. There were several empty water bottles under his bed and boxes of used medical supplies just laying on the floor. The carpet was disgusting. There were many straps of his meds in boxes as well. Was he even getting his meds. Bottom line..I DO NOT RECOMMEND THE RICHMOND for your loved one at all!!!!!!

This retirement home contrasted poorly with Amica. It was an older building with no sir conditioning nor WiFi. While it too offered similar meals, games area, it had fewer areas for the residents to enjoy, fewer facilities such as no pool. With about 85 residents it is much smaller and more intimate than Amica with its 200+ residents.Similarly priced it appears to be less of a bargain.My tour guide Marion was very engaging and helpful. She took steps to show me a variety of rooms.
